Note that on my systems I just make heavy use of the various load-average 
limiting options and as long as two of the big packages don't start within 
seconds of each other it does a pretty good job of letting them run by 
themselves.

If things do get in a snarl, you can always use kill -18/19 to suspend a few 
compile jobs until the system stops thrashing and resume them as capacity 
permits.
